- Early life and training: Ganga Sasidharan was born in Kerala, India, and began learning violin at the age of five. She studied under some of the most renowned violinists in India, including Lalgudi Jayaraman and M.S. Gopalakrishnan.
- Professional career: Ganga Sasidharan made her debut as a soloist at the age of 16. She has since performed extensively worldwide and has collaborated with some of the biggest names in Carnatic music, including M.S. Subbulakshmi, Ravi Shankar, and Zakir Hussain.
- Musical style: Ganga Sasidharan is known for her unique musical style, which blends traditional Carnatic techniques with contemporary elements. She is also known for her improvisational skills and her ability to create new and innovative pieces of music.
- Awards and honors: Ganga Sasidharan has received numerous awards and honors for her work, including the Padma Shri, the Sangeet Natak Akademi Award, and the Kalaimamani Award.
- Personal life: Ganga Sasidharan is married to violinist V.V. Subramaniam. The couple has two children.
